The projects that AHSECA aimed to complete were identified during the onsite evaluation process which took place
in May 2008. During that visit, we acknowledged the urgent needs and we decided on how to respond to the requests. During the evaluation process, AHSECA narrowed the most urgent needs to school books, reading books, office supplies, clothes and toys. This request is currently greatly satisfied. Indeed, in January 2009, a 20’ container was sent from France to Conakry through Antwerp in Belgium on the boat “Manx Lion”; it arrived at Conakry on February 2nd. Onboard, one year collection of articles for the 1300 schoolchilds of Farmoriah, and the 200 schoolchilds of Barenfory in Guinea-Conakry.
